Installation Tips

Proper installation of the 350x3 ball bearing is crucial for ensuring optimal performance and longevity. Here are some key installation tips:

1. Cleanliness: Ensure that the installation area is clean and free of debris. Any contamination can lead to premature wear and failure of the bearing.
2. Alignment: Proper alignment of the bearing is essential for smooth operation. Use alignment tools and techniques to ensure that the bearing is correctly positioned.
3. Lubrication: Apply the appropriate lubricant to the bearing during installation. This will reduce friction, minimize wear, and extend the bearing's lifespan.

Maintenance Tips

Regular maintenance of the 350x3 ball bearing is essential for ensuring its optimal performance and longevity. Here are some key maintenance tips:

1. Inspection: Regularly inspect the bearing for signs of wear, damage, or contamination. This will help identify potential issues early and prevent costly repairs or replacements.
2. Cleaning: Clean the bearing and its surrounding components regularly to remove debris and contaminants. This will help maintain smooth operation and prevent premature wear.
3. Lubrication: Reapply lubricant as needed to ensure proper lubrication and reduce friction. This will help extend the bearing's lifespan and improve its performance.
